Results for 'hukarere'

hukarere - snow

Hukarere, n. 1. Snow. Kei pehia koe e te anu o te hukarere (M. 171).

2. Foam driven by the wind.

Williams Dictionary

E heke ana te hukarere.
The snow is falling.
Simple sentences: present tense - e... ana

Kua uhia te maunga ki te hukarere.
The mountain is covered in snow.
Simple sentences: past completed tense - kua
